While doing surgery for meningioma, left paracentral lobule got injured. This will lead to paresis of:

A
Left face
B
Right neck and scapular region
C
Right leg and perineum
D
Right shoulder and trunk
High-Yield Explanation
Para-central lobule present near the midline encroaching upon the medial surface of the hemisphere and is the continuation of the precentral and postcentral gyri. The paracentral lobule controls motor and sensory innervations of the contralateral lower limb and pa of perineal region. It is also responsible for control of bladder and bowel (defecation and urination).
